Output 1681f1d83dee12903bcab7e6aed69f5a613a004792a804b3db2e5eef4e403905: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69c7a285ea6114047397063590e69011e3fc5fe9 OP_EQUAL
address
3BLL2ZNRGjv4HqvLzd9d24tnXmwCT1WFw4
transaction
1681f1d83dee12903bcab7e6aed69f5a613a004792a804b3db2e5eef4e403905
confirmations
432835
spent
true